Here we look into numerous popular approaches:
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T): This method is based on the property that negative thoughts cause negative feelings and behaviors. CBT assists people find out to challenge and change those negative idea patterns, replace them with more useful ones, and manage their feelings much better.
Social Therapy (IPT): IPT focuses on individual relationships and social performance and assists customers identify and attend to social issues adding to their depression. It is reliable for those whose signs are carefully connected to relationship characteristics.
Mindfulness-Based Therapy: This technique utilizes mindfulness practices to improve emotional awareness and acceptance. Clients are taught to observe their ideas and feelings without judgment, promoting a sense of peace and reducing anxiety connected with depressive signs.
Supportive Counseling: Although less structured than other modalities, supportive counseling supplies empathy, support, and connection. This technique can be incredibly important for individuals who need an area to reveal their feelings and crises.
1. The length of time does counseling for depression generally last?
The period of counseling differs depending on private needs and objectives. Some individuals may gain from short-term therapy (6-12 sessions), while others may need long-term therapy that spans a number of months or years.
2. Is depression counseling efficient?
Yes, numerous research studies show that counseling, particularly when integrated with medication, is effective in decreasing depressive symptoms and improving total mental health. The key to success frequently lies in discovering the best therapist and method.
3. Can counseling replace medication for depression?
Counseling can be extremely efficient for some people, and many choose it over medication. However, for others, a mix of therapy and medication may yield the very best outcomes. A healthcare professional can assist figure out the most ideal method.
4. What can I expect during a counseling session?
In a typical counseling session, you can anticipate to discuss your feelings, issues, and experiences with your therapist. They might ask questions to gain a deeper understanding of your situation, and together you will explore coping strategies and treatment goals.
5. Exist any dangers related to depression counseling?
While counseling is generally safe, it can bring up agonizing emotions and topics. It's essential to work with an experienced therapist who can provide a supportive environment to browse these sensations efficiently.
